E-SHEF Company is your best source for high-quality, healthy herbs, spices, and foods straight from Egypt. Founded in 2018 by Egyptian native, E-SHEF is dedicated to bringing the unique flavors and health benefits of Egyptian cuisine to customers around the world. The company works directly with small farms across Egypt to source premium ingredients like aromatic spices, nutrient-dense ancient grains, and healing herbs that have been used in Egyptian cooking for centuries.

Every E-SHEF product is carefully hand-selected and packaged to maintain freshness and potency. Their expansive catalog includes hard-to-find spices like Nigella sativa, known as black cumin, which contains antioxidants and anti-inflammatory compounds. You’ll also find organic, sustainably grown staples like fava beans, a good source of protein, fiber, and vitamins. Or try their fragrant dried hibiscus, which can be brewed into a tart, vitamin C-rich tea.
